Output 5730198e861c8c916618b5a6214da903a929b1a86bb6e8f63879e745532b2b3a:1

value
110892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d95a7e37c764117e98ad20fe19d276dce2816b7f OP_EQUAL
address
3MWGxjjE2QthstUTvhqayT5cWGmX4imU9C
transaction
5730198e861c8c916618b5a6214da903a929b1a86bb6e8f63879e745532b2b3a
confirmations
193383
spent
true